Mamoudzou is the capital of the French overseas region and department of Mayotte, in the Indian Ocean. Mamoudzou is the most populated commune (municipality) of Mayotte. It is located on Grande-Terre (or Mahoré), the main island of Mayotte. Most of Mayotte’s shops, restaurants and businesses are concentrated in Mamoudzou, and the neighbouring industrial zone of Kaweni.
Seize the End of Summer with Recipes Inspired by Favorite American Hot Weather Travel Destinations
The kids are back to school (whatever that looks like this year for your near... read more
First In-Person New Cruise Ship Delivery Since Pandemic Lockdown: The Silver Origin
Silversea has welcomed its first-ever destination-specific ship, the Silver O... read more
Four Places You Can Try the Newest Tropical Resort Trend
The latest craze at tropical resorts will really ‘float your boat.’ Swim up b... read more
The Biggest W Hotel in the World has Opened on Sydney’s Harbourfront with a Spectacular Wave Design
They like to make a splash Down Under. So it’s no surprise the long-anticipat... read more
New, Luxury Water Park Makes a ‘Splash’ in the Bahamas
If you’ve never put the words ‘luxury’ and ‘water park’ together in a sentenc... read more
Juno Beach Centre
The Juno Beach Centre is Canada’s Second World War museum and cultural centre... read more
